ABSTRACT

 

This study seeks to synthesize an ultra-stable zeolite-Y from local sediments for the treatment of crude oil extraction produce water.

 Zeolite was produced by the hydrothermal synthesis method using an autoclave. Batch adsorption experiment experiments were performed in a stoppered 250ml conical flask in a speed-controlled orbital shaker with continuous shaking at150rpmto study the effect of dosage concentration and contact time.

The results of XRF confirms that the ratio of 2.48:1 silicon to Aluminum which is similar to faujasite, FAU known as zeolite-Y. The scanning electron microscopy shows that the zeolite had a highly porous structure, with many small pores on the surface. The result of the adsorption experiment shows that the rate of nitrate removal from the solution increases with increase in contact time. The results of analysis of produced water before and after treatment shows that Mn, Sr, Na and Zn was completely removed from the solution and Ca, Mg, Tl, Fe and K has a very high %removal of 90.86%, 88.42%, 72.73%, 68.85% and 66.91% respectively.
